## Approvals: GraphQL N+1 Fix

Support folks, heads up: the fix for the slow Perchwell dashboard (that nasty N+1 on nested orders) ships behind a flag this week. Don't toggle it for customers yourself — each enablement needs an approval note in the rollout tracker. All flag approvals for this fix go through the engineer named below.

account owner for bawip-tahag: Raleth Quenok

Hey — quick handover for the sync. The Ledgerloom billing worker is now fully on blue-green deploys; traffic flips via the router flag, no more drain scripts. Green pool validated against last month's invoice batch with zero diffs. One gotcha: keep both pools on identical settings or reconciliation drifts. The values both pools currently run with appear below.

config for hahaf-kafof:
[wenys]
host = wenys.torvahq.corp
user = wenys_svc
database = wenys_prod

# Artifact Signing — Nightly Reindex (Support FAQ)

Hey folks — quick refresher. Every night, Lumara's search reindex job publishes a signed artifact so downstream nodes know it wasn't tampered with. If a customer reports stale results, first check that last night's artifact verified cleanly. You can validate it yourself with the tool on the ops box. The current signing key is shown below.

signing key of bagap-yawep = bky13_TbfT6ZMUoGJo2

Subject: Consent banner cut-over done

Team — the Brimveil consent banner is fully cut over as of last night. Old banner service is drained; traffic is 100% on the new stack. Saw one spike in opt-out latency during the flip, resolved by bumping the cache TTL. No rollbacks needed. Legal signed off on the updated copy this morning. Remaining cleanup: delete the legacy buckets next sprint. The live configuration we cut over to is below.

deployment values, kajep-kageg:
[praix]
host = praix.paliqcorp.corp
user = praix_svc
database = praix_prod

**Grapheline: rendering budget.** The visualizer lays out dependency graphs incrementally so large workspaces stay responsive during a release cut. Layout runs in bounded passes; if the node count exceeds the pass budget, we collapse leaf clusters and defer edge routing to idle frames. For the release build, these budgets are fixed rather than adaptive, so results are reproducible across machines. The constants the release build ships with are shown below.

tuning table, hafog-bahaf:
QUOTAS = {
    "praion": 144,
    "briax": 906,
    "silwyn": 451,
}